Template:Species-infobox Diggas are Bullet Bill-like enemies appearing in Super Mario Galaxy 2; they are first located in the Spin-Dig Galaxy. Diggas are similar to Drill Moles from Super Mario Land 2: 6 Golden Coins, only instead of burrowing underground and attacking Mario, Diggas drill with their body exposed and ignore Mario. They have a yellow body, a drill for a nose, angry eyes, and no arms or legs. They can be easily destroyed by a Jump or with a Spin Drill. They can also be summoned by the boss Digga-Leg.
